Barcelona head coach Xavi refused to hold back, in taking aim at both the officials responsible for overseeing his side’s defeat to Real Madrid, and La Liga as a whole.

Barca, of course, were back in action late last night, making the trip to Spain’s capital for the latest edition of El Clásico.


OneFootball Videos


The Blaugrana headed into proceedings in the knowledge that nothing but a victory would suffice, in keeping alive their feint hopes of retaining the La Liga title.

When all was said and done, however, despite twice taking the lead on the night, Xavi and co. were ultimately forced to face up to the wrong side of a 3-2 result.

As much came after goals on the part of Vinícius Jr and Lucas Vázquez were followed by a Jude Bellingham dagger right at the death, to break the hearts of Barcelona fans the world over for the 2nd time in the space of a week.

Barca’s eventual downing, however, did not come without its controversies.

The first-half spot-kick awarded to Real Madrid was disputed by many, adamant that Lucas Vázquez initiated the contact before going to ground.

The real moment of contention on the night, though, came upon the visitors being denied what they felt was an evident goal.

After Lamine Yamal’s flick-on at the near post made its way towards the hosts’ goal, Andriy Lunin shoveled the ball out, culminating in a corner.

With no goal-line technology in Spanish football, it was in turn up to the VAR team to decipher whether or not Lamine’s effort had crossed the line.

In the end, after a lengthy review spanning several minutes, it was decided that a goal would not be awarded.

And, as alluded to above, when drawn on as much post-match, Barcelona headmaster Xavi simply refused to bite his tongue.

In a frankly remarkable rant which could yet land him in hot water with the Spanish football authorities, the 44-year-old began:

“The referee didn’t get a single decision right.”

Turning focus towards La Liga’s shortcomings as a division, he continued:

“It’s embarrassing that La Liga doesn’t have goal-line technology.

“The league that we consider to be the best in the world does not have goal-line technology! Everyone saw it, the ball went in!

“It was unfair. It is very clear. Everyone saw it. My feeling today is one of maximum injustice.

“I repeat, it was a huge injustice today. Shameful.”

Xavi then doubled down on his criticism of referee César Soto, adding:

“Today the referee neither made the right decisions nor did it go unnoticed. It’s the only thing I asked for yesterday at the press conference.

“Since the beginning of the season in Getafe, I said that I do not like what is happening and that everything is hurting us, and today was the end of this story,” he concluded.
